Zonisamide Drug Level Blood Test

North Dakota rates for HCPCS 80203

A blood test that measures the amount of zonisamide, a medication used to treat seizures, present in the bloodstream. Doctors use this test to make sure the dose is high enough to control seizures while staying within a safe range and avoiding side effects. Blood is typically drawn at a consistent time relative to a dose to get an accurate reading.
